The typical American commute has been getting longer each year since 2010. The average one-way commute in Harrisville (zip 48740) takes 20.7 minutes. That's shorter than the US average of 26.4 minutes.
How people in Harrisville (zip 48740) get to work:
- 80.9% drive their own car alone
- 9.0% carpool with others
- 4.6% work from home
- 0.4% take mass transit
